We currently have a bug where the symbol resolution depends on the order 
of alternatives along a hash bucket list:

   <https://sourceware.org/bugzilla/show_bug.cgi?id=12977#c2>

Another open problem is what happens when a versioned symbol moves from 
one DSO to another.  This is not a problem for unversioned symbols, but 
we currently have a soname check for versioned symbols.  This is rather 
odd because this check isn't used to accelerate lookups.  It does not 
prevent symbol interposition from other DSOs, it merely introduces 
spurious failures.

> 7. The way to remove a versioned symbol from a new release
>     of a shared library is to not define a default version
>     (NAME@@VERSION) for that symbol. (Right?)
> 
>     In other words, if we wanted to create a VER_4 of lib_ver.so
>     that removed the symbol 'abc', we simply don't create use
>     the usual asm(".symver") magic to create abc@VER_4.

You still need to use .symver, but with a @ version instead of a @@ version.
